@@ -13,17 +13,18 @@ if (!$block->getButtonLockManager()) {
1313 $ objectManager ->get (\Magento \Framework \View \Element \ButtonLockManager::class)
1414 );
1515}
16+ /** @var $escaper \Magento\Framework\Escaper */
1617/** @var \Magento\Framework\View\Helper\SecureHtmlRenderer $secureRenderer */
1718?>
1819<form class="form form-edit-account"
19- action="<?= $ block ->escapeUrl ($ block ->getUrl ('customer/account/editPost ' )) ?> "
20+ action="<?= $ escaper ->escapeUrl ($ block ->getUrl ('customer/account/editPost ' )) ?> "
2021 method="post" id="form-validate"
2122 enctype="multipart/form-data"
22- data-hasrequired="<?= $ block ->escapeHtmlAttr (__ ('* Required Fields ' )) ?> "
23+ data-hasrequired="<?= $ escaper ->escapeHtmlAttr (__ ('* Required Fields ' )) ?> "
2324 autocomplete="off">
2425 <fieldset class="fieldset info">
2526 <?= $ block ->getBlockHtml ('formkey ' ) ?>
26- <legend class="legend"><span><?= $ block ->escapeHtml (__ ('Account Information ' )) ?> </span></legend><br>
27+ <legend class="legend"><span><?= $ escaper ->escapeHtml (__ ('Account Information ' )) ?> </span></legend><br>
2728 <?= $ block ->getLayout ()->createBlock (Name::class)->setObject ($ block ->getCustomer ())->toHtml () ?>
2829
2930 <?php $ _dob = $ block ->getLayout ()->createBlock (\Magento \Customer \Block \Widget \Dob::class) ?>
@@ -40,39 +41,39 @@ if (!$block->getButtonLockManager()) {
4041 <?php endif ?>
4142 <div class="field choice">
4243 <input type="checkbox" name="change_email" id="change-email" data-role="change-email" value="1"
43- title="<?= $ block ->escapeHtmlAttr (__ ('Change Email ' )) ?> " class="checkbox" />
44+ title="<?= $ escaper ->escapeHtmlAttr (__ ('Change Email ' )) ?> " class="checkbox" />
4445 <label class="label" for="change-email">
45- <span><?= $ block ->escapeHtml (__ ('Change Email ' )) ?> </span>
46+ <span><?= $ escaper ->escapeHtml (__ ('Change Email ' )) ?> </span>
4647 </label>
4748 </div>
4849 <div class="field choice">
4950 <input type="checkbox" name="change_password" id="change-password" data-role="change-password" value="1"
50- title="<?= $ block ->escapeHtmlAttr (__ ('Change Password ' )) ?> "
51+ title="<?= $ escaper ->escapeHtmlAttr (__ ('Change Password ' )) ?> "
5152 <?php if ($ block ->getChangePassword ()): ?> checked="checked"<?php endif ; ?> class="checkbox" />
5253 <label class="label" for="change-password">
53- <span><?= $ block ->escapeHtml (__ ('Change Password ' )) ?> </span>
54+ <span><?= $ escaper ->escapeHtml (__ ('Change Password ' )) ?> </span>
5455 </label>
5556 </div>
5657 <?= $ block ->getChildHtml ('fieldset_edit_info_additional ' ) ?>
5758 </fieldset>
5859
5960 <fieldset class="fieldset password" data-container="change-email-password">
6061 <legend class="legend">
61- <span data-title="change-email-password"><?= $ block ->escapeHtml (__ ('Change Email and Password ' )) ?> </span>
62+ <span data-title="change-email-password"><?= $ escaper ->escapeHtml (__ ('Change Email and Password ' )) ?> </span>
6263 </legend><br>
6364 <div class="field email required" data-container="change-email">
64- <label class="label" for="email"><span><?= $ block ->escapeHtml (__ ('Email ' )) ?> </span></label>
65+ <label class="label" for="email"><span><?= $ escaper ->escapeHtml (__ ('Email ' )) ?> </span></label>
6566 <div class="control">
6667 <input type="email" name="email" id="email" autocomplete="email" data-input="change-email"
67- value="<?= $ block ->escapeHtmlAttr ($ block ->getCustomer ()->getEmail ()) ?> "
68- title="<?= $ block ->escapeHtmlAttr (__ ('Email ' )) ?> "
68+ value="<?= $ escaper ->escapeHtmlAttr ($ block ->getCustomer ()->getEmail ()) ?> "
69+ title="<?= $ escaper ->escapeHtmlAttr (__ ('Email ' )) ?> "
6970 class="input-text"
7071 data-validate="{required:true, 'validate-email':true}" />
7172 </div>
7273 </div>
7374 <div class="field password current required">
7475 <label class="label" for="current-password">
75- <span><?= $ block ->escapeHtml (__ ('Current Password ' )) ?> </span>
76+ <span><?= $ escaper ->escapeHtml (__ ('Current Password ' )) ?> </span>
7677 </label>
7778 <div class="control">
7879 <input type="password" class="input-text" name="current_password" id="current-password"
@@ -81,28 +82,28 @@ if (!$block->getButtonLockManager()) {
8182 </div>
8283 </div>
8384 <div class="field new password required" data-container="new-password">
84- <label class="label" for="password"><span><?= $ block ->escapeHtml (__ ('New Password ' )) ?> </span></label>
85+ <label class="label" for="password"><span><?= $ escaper ->escapeHtml (__ ('New Password ' )) ?> </span></label>
8586 <div class="control">
8687 <?php $ minCharacterSets = $ block ->getRequiredCharacterClassesNumber () ?>
8788 <input type="password" class="input-text" name="password" id="password"
88- data-password-min-length="<?= $ block ->escapeHtml ($ block ->getMinimumPasswordLength ()) ?> "
89- data-password-min-character-sets="<?= $ block ->escapeHtml ($ minCharacterSets ) ?> "
89+ data-password-min-length="<?= $ escaper ->escapeHtml ($ block ->getMinimumPasswordLength ()) ?> "
90+ data-password-min-character-sets="<?= $ escaper ->escapeHtml ($ minCharacterSets ) ?> "
9091 data-input="new-password"
9192 data-validate="{required:true, 'validate-customer-password':true}"
9293 autocomplete="off" />
9394 <div id="password-strength-meter-container" data-role="password-strength-meter" aria-live="polite">
9495 <div id="password-strength-meter" class="password-strength-meter">
95- <?= $ block ->escapeHtml (__ ('Password Strength ' )) ?> :
96+ <?= $ escaper ->escapeHtml (__ ('Password Strength ' )) ?> :
9697 <span id="password-strength-meter-label" data-role="password-strength-meter-label">
97- <?= $ block ->escapeHtml (__ ('No Password ' )) ?>
98+ <?= $ escaper ->escapeHtml (__ ('No Password ' )) ?>
9899 </span>
99100 </div>
100101 </div>
101102 </div>
102103 </div>
103104 <div class="field confirmation password required" data-container="confirm-password">
104105 <label class="label" for="password-confirmation">
105- <span><?= $ block ->escapeHtml (__ ('Confirm New Password ' )) ?> </span>
106+ <span><?= $ escaper ->escapeHtml (__ ('Confirm New Password ' )) ?> </span>
106107 </label>
107108 <div class="control">
108109 <input type="password" class="input-text" name="password_confirmation" id="password-confirmation"
@@ -121,16 +122,16 @@ if (!$block->getButtonLockManager()) {
121122
122123 <div class="actions-toolbar">
123124 <div class="primary">
124- <button type="submit" class="action save primary" title="<?= $ block ->escapeHtmlAttr (__ ('Save ' )) ?> "
125+ <button type="submit" class="action save primary" title="<?= $ escaper ->escapeHtmlAttr (__ ('Save ' )) ?> "
125126 <?php if ($ block ->getButtonLockManager ()->isDisabled ('customer_edit_form_submit ' )): ?>
126127 disabled="disabled"
127128 <?php endif ; ?> >
128- <span><?= $ block ->escapeHtml (__ ('Save ' )) ?> </span>
129+ <span><?= $ escaper ->escapeHtml (__ ('Save ' )) ?> </span>
129130 </button>
130131 </div>
131132 <div class="secondary">
132- <a class="action back" href="<?= $ block ->escapeUrl ($ block ->getBackUrl ()) ?> ">
133- <span><?= $ block ->escapeHtml (__ ('Go back ' )) ?> </span>
133+ <a class="action back" href="<?= $ escaper ->escapeUrl ($ block ->getBackUrl ()) ?> ">
134+ <span><?= $ escaper ->escapeHtml (__ ('Go back ' )) ?> </span>
134135 </a>
135136 </div>
136137 </div>
@@ -174,14 +175,14 @@ $scriptString .= <<<script
174175script ;
175176?>
176177<?= /* @noEscape */ $ secureRenderer ->renderTag ('script ' , [], $ scriptString , false ) ?>
177- <?php $ changeEmailAndPasswordTitle = $ block ->escapeHtml (__ ('Change Email and Password ' )) ?>
178+ <?php $ changeEmailAndPasswordTitle = $ escaper ->escapeHtml (__ ('Change Email and Password ' )) ?>
178179<script type="text/x-magento-init">
179180 {
180181 "[data-role=change-email], [data-role=change-password]": {
181182 "changeEmailPassword": {
182- "titleChangeEmail": "<?= $ block ->escapeJs ($ block ->escapeHtml (__ ('Change Email ' ))) ?> ",
183- "titleChangePassword": "<?= $ block ->escapeJs ($ block ->escapeHtml (__ ('Change Password ' ))) ?> ",
184- "titleChangeEmailAndPassword": "<?= $ block ->escapeJs ($ changeEmailAndPasswordTitle ) ?> "
183+ "titleChangeEmail": "<?= $ escaper ->escapeJs ($ escaper ->escapeHtml (__ ('Change Email ' ))) ?> ",
184+ "titleChangePassword": "<?= $ escaper ->escapeJs ($ escaper ->escapeHtml (__ ('Change Password ' ))) ?> ",
185+ "titleChangeEmailAndPassword": "<?= $ escaper ->escapeJs ($ changeEmailAndPasswordTitle ) ?> "
185186 }
186187 },
187188 "[data-container=new-password]": {
0 commit comments